墨尘样品管理系统技术架构解析:如何支撑高并发样品流转
在直播电商的爆发式增长中,样品管理的效率直接决定了达人合作的转化速度。深圳墨尘贸易有限公司自研的墨尘样品管理系统,通过一套独创的技术架构,在高并发场景下实现了样品流转的零延迟与全链路可视化。今天,我们从技术视角拆解这套系统如何支撑每日数万笔样品订单的平稳运转。
核心架构:分布式任务调度与状态机引擎
系统底层采用**事件驱动型分布式架构**,核心是一套自定义的状态机引擎。当直播达人通过直播达人客户管理系统发起样品申请时,系统并非简单记录数据,而是将每个样品包裹的生命周期拆解为“申请-审核-出库-物流-签收-反馈”六个原子状态。每个状态变更都会触发预定义的并行任务:例如“签收”事件会同步更新抖快小店样品管理工具的库存数据,并向达人端推送评测提醒。这种设计让系统在双十一等峰值时段,仍能保持平均200ms内的状态更新响应。
为了应对抖快平台瞬时涌入的批量申请,我们引入了**两级缓存预热策略**。第一级基于Redis Cluster缓存热门达人的样品偏好与地址信息,第二级使用本地内存缓存高频查询的库存模型。实测数据显示,该策略将80%的读取请求命中缓存,数据库QPS从峰值12000降至2400以下,有效避免了IO瓶颈。
数据一致性:分布式事务与补偿机制
样品流转涉及财务、仓储、物流多系统协同,资金与库存的强一致性是硬性要求。我们放弃了传统两阶段提交(2PC)方案,转而采用**TCC(Try-Confirm/Cancel)柔性事务模型**。以“样品出库”操作为例:Try阶段锁定库存并预占物流单号,Confirm阶段真正扣减并生成出库单;若超时或失败,Cancel阶段自动释放资源。这套机制结合贸易行业 CRM 管理系统的审批流,将账实不符率控制在0.03%以下。
- 库存锁粒度优化:按SKU+仓库维度拆分锁,避免热点商品锁竞争。
- 物流状态补偿:每5分钟扫描异常包裹,自动触发重新路由或补发。
- 达人信用积分:集成直播电商客户样品管理模块,高信用达人可跳过预审流程。
仓储环节的硬件适配同样关键。系统对接了主流仓储自动化设备(如AGV小车、电子标签拣货台),通过WebSocket实时推送拣货指令。某次压力测试中,单仓同时处理3000个样品出库任务,WMS系统响应延迟始终低于0.5秒,未出现指令丢失或重复执行的情况。
案例:某头部MCN机构的高并发实战
去年双12大促期间,一家合作MCN机构通过墨尘 CRM 样品管理系统向5000位达人批量发放样品。峰值时刻每秒产生200+申请,系统通过自动扩容策略(Kubernetes HPA)在30秒内将服务节点从8个扩展至25个。数据库层采用读写分离+分库分表(按达人ID哈希分片),最终平稳处理了12万笔样品申请,全程无卡顿。该机构的运营总监反馈:“以往需要3人加班核对的数据,现在系统10分钟自动生成对账单,差错率为零。”
这套架构的价值不止于技术指标。它让直播达人客户管理系统的样品流转从“黑盒”变为“透明工厂”,达人可实时查看包裹轨迹与审核进度;财务部门能按达人等级、样品类目自动生成结算报表。对于贸易公司而言,当样品管理从成本中心转化为数据资产时,高并发能力就成了撬动业务增长的支点。